Fly to the mighty Victoria Falls. Known in a local language as Mosi-oa-Tunya, or “The Smoke That Thunders,” Victoria Falls straddles the border of Zambia and Zimbabwe and plummets some 354 feet into the gorge below. At over five thousand feet wide, it is the world’s largest falling sheet of water. Your secluded lodge is on a private section of riverbank, just a short distance from the falls themselves. Journey across the border to Botswana and your next safari destination. Though most famous for its huge concentration of elephants, Chobe National Park is one of the most biologically diverse parks in Africa and is home to an impressive wealth of animal life. There is no better place to watch elephants frolic and swim in the water as they come down to the banks of the Chobe River to play. Buffalo, zebra, hippos, lion, wild dog, leopard and cheetah, as well as hundreds of bird species, are all spotted regularly here. Game drives and boat cruises are on offer as this park showcases its huge herds and diverse wildlife. This afternoon, head out for your first game drive in this exceptional national park.

Explore the Okavango Delta, a unique natural phenomenon. The Khwai Concession is a pristine private reserve, nestled in the heart of the Okavango and bordering the famous Moremi Game Reserve. It is a paradise of grasslands, floodplains, lagoons and forests, and a focal point of the area is the Khwai River, which attracts an unparalleled amount of wildlife.
Large elephant herds roam the reserve, along with sable and roan antelope, kudu, wildebeest, and zebra, as well as those that prey on them: lions, hyenas and wild dogs. Hundreds of bird species also make their home here. As this is a private reserve, you will have the option to do a night drive, offering you the added benefit of seeing the nocturnal animals, which keep a low profile during the daylight hours.
